The top Firewood in your Wooden Stove or Fireplace

All wood burns, although not all woods burn off exactly the same. Some melt away hotter, slower, and cleaner than Many others. Some smoke lots, and many have a great deal of sap or resin that clogs your chimney rapidly. The best sorts of firewood to get a Wooden stove or fireplace melt away sizzling and comparatively steadily, producing far more warmth and, usually, burning far more wholly. These woods are usually hardwoods, for example hickory or ash, instead of softwoods, including pine and cedar.
Hardwood Firewood

Hardwoods for instance maple, oak, ash, birch, and many fruit trees are the very best burning woods that provides you with a hotter and for a longer period burn time. These woods have the least pitch and sap and therefore are typically cleaner to manage. On the other hand, hardwoods are frequently dearer than softwoods and tend to be more at risk of depart clinkers, a hard and stony residue, inside the leftover ash.

Should you be burning birch firewood, know about the thick internal brown bark called the phloem. This bark retains lots of humidity and might protect against the wood from drying evenly.1 Therefore, it's best to mix birch with Yet another kind of hardwood to get a cleaner melt away and less smoke. Smoke results in a buildup of creosote, that is a byproduct of Wooden combustion consisting largely of tar that typically causes chimney fires.two
Softwood Firewood

Softwood is the cheapest variety of wood You should purchase. Fir is your best option, but other softwoods consist of pine, balsam, spruce, cedar, tamarack, alder, and poplar. Softwoods tend to burn off quicker and depart finer ash when compared with hardwoods.three Additionally they is usually messy to deal with, especially pine, spruce, and balsam, because they induce creosote to create up extra swiftly in the chimney.
Comparing Firewood by Heat Strength

Different firewoods could be classified by the level of warmth Power they make for every wire of wood. The most effective firewoods present the warmth-energy equivalent of 200 to 250 gallons of fuel oil.4 These contain the next:

Apple
Beech (American)
Birch (Yellow)
Hickory (Shagbark)
Ironwood
Maple (Sugar)
Purple oak
White ash
White oak

The subsequent classification of warmth Electrical power is the equal of a hundred and fifty to two hundred gallons of gasoline for every twine of firewood. These woods include things like:

Birch (White)
Cherry (Black)
Douglas fir
Elm (American)
Maple (Pink and Silver)
Tamarack

In the bottom heat-Strength class, Every single twine of wood produces regarding the exact same warmth as a hundred to one hundred fifty gallons of fuel oil:

Alder (Red)
Aspen
Cedar (Pink)
Cottonwood
Hemlock
Pine (Lodgepole and White)
Redwood
Spruce (Sitka)

Ensure that Your Wood Is Dry

You ought to in no way burn "environmentally friendly," or insufficiently dried, wood as it provides fewer heat and much more smoke (and, ultimately, creosote) than thoroughly dried, or seasoned, wood. For proper storage, you'll want to stack your wood for efficient air circulation, protected at the top only, and ensure it's thoroughly dry in advance of burning. more info An excellent general guideline is always to rotate your firewood, as in burning the more mature dryer wood 1st, to prevent Wooden rot and squander.

Wooden should have a dampness content of a lot less that twenty % for burning. While using the moisture previously mentioned twenty p.c, wood is hard to start out and burns improperly and inefficiently, making abnormal quantities of h2o vapor, smoke, and harmful air.five
Woods to Avoid

Salvaged firewood or other scraps can help you save lots of money With regards to heating your property with wood. But there are actually particular wood items together with other merchandise that you need to avoid for wellness and protection good reasons. Many of such will produce harmful fumes indoors, as well as chimney emissions that may be an environmental issue.six Some also pose added pitfalls to the stove metals or can produce a hazardous buildup of creosote in your chimney.

For your protection it is best to constantly keep away from burning:

Painted or varnished wood, trim, or other Wooden by-items
Pressure-addressed lumber
Driftwood
Engineered sheet products, including plywood, particleboard, and MDF
Hardboard or other compressed paper products6

In the event you have problems with allergy symptoms, some woods, Specifically aromatic cedar, also needs to be utilised with caution.
